Tolerance Group 5 (TG5) is a high-precision classification. It is typically specified for technical components that require exact fits and functional interfaces, such as gears, electronic housings, and automotive sub-assemblies.

is the specific high-accuracy tolerance group under the German engineering standard for plastic injection molded components, prescribing structural dimensions and production deviations. Unlike metal fabrication, where uniform standard tolerances like ISO 2768-mk apply globally, plastic injection molding undergoes dynamic changes due to processing shrinkage, material properties, and mold architecture. Selecting TG5 indicates a demand for precision-level engineering tolerances , typically designated for standard high-end injection molding applications where functional fit is essential.
